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
903859536 31653135 41 01616
6410394 048 352
6410394 048 352
325269 7729829441 339
All about undefined
Interested in learning more?
6410394 048 352
325269 7729829441 339
See more
56957 852455 643149
27 78513 66980674150 915792 8735
See more
393291 7771 77
9206773 16317919018 050920 18
See more